What is Fresh hand-picked apples?

Fresh hand-picked apples are a type of fruit harvested directly from apple trees. They are valued for their fresh taste and natural sweetness, coming in varieties such as Fuji, Gala, and Granny Smith.

Apples are commonly used in a wide range of food products because of their flavor and nutritional benefits. They provide vitamins like vitamin C and dietary fiber, which are beneficial for digestive health. Eating fresh apples is encouraged as part of a balanced diet due to their antioxidant properties.

When you see fresh hand-picked apples on a label, it signifies the use of real fruit in the product, contributing natural flavor and potential nutritional benefits.

Commonly found in: fruit salads, snacks, desserts, juices, sauces, baked goods

Benefits

  • Rich in dietary fiber, promoting digestive health.
  • Contains vitamin C, which supports immune function.
  • Provides natural sweetness without added sugars.
FDA

Apples are generally recognized as safe and are widely consumed as a wholesome fruit.

Research

Consuming apples is associated with various health benefits, including improved heart health and reduced risk of some diseases.

Vegan

Apples are naturally vegan and are acceptable in plant-based diets.
